Quick Assessment
This board book combines tactile baby Gund toys with a built-in mirror to engage young children during bath time. Designed for toddlers and preschoolers, it encourages self-recognition and sensory exploration in a safe, waterproof format. Parents can expect a durable, age-appropriate book that supports daily routines and early developmental skills.
